  • LoS Act 1 Warrior/Rogue build

    SPOILERS
    -------------------

    After the Mage build, it is time for the Warrior/Rogue Act 1 build.
    There is isn't a specific set for the Warrior/Rogue, so you can choose to collect the Spindlesilk (doing the correct choice before the battle with Spindle) and sell the items for 20 gold each or don't collect the Spindlesilk; the latter is the choice i made for this build.

    Bat Leather/Crocodile Skin or Damaged Shield/Crocodile Skin can combine to have good items for Warrior/Rogue, but again, i made a different choice/path.

    So i played Act 1 more freely respect to the Mage build, because there are some good options.

    This is the order in which i played the quests:
    Village: 6
    Easy: 15, 22, 10
    Average: 66, 4
    Hard: 111, 72
    Legendary: 29, 18
    Hardest: 87
    Legendary: 49
    Hard: 25
    Boss: 97

    I played the Stone Circle (25, Hard Quest), right before the last fight with the Boss Monster, because i have reached Speed 8! and i defeated Noldor without using the runes (Special Achievement!).
    If you are not interested in this Special Achievement, you can use the runes and keep your main hand weapon; at that point you should have or the Ancient Sword, bleed (pa) or the Venomous Fang, venom (pa), both very good weapons that do a good combo with the first cut (pa) ability.

    N.B: The Warrior/Rogue path has a more specific route to find a very strong "Head" item; But you need to find 3 keys: two in Act 1, and one in Act 2...and another item, but since it isn't difficult enough...you must solve also a puzzle! But it is not over, icing on the cake: the last path is chosen randomly!
    Anyway, also the Mage can achieve it, but the key's path in Act 2 has more potential for the Warrior/Rogue, if the luck is on your side!

    N.B.: Spider leg and Ghoul hair can be mixed with other items and be useful during Act 2 to boost your Brawn and Armour (potions).

    These are the Act 1 final stats:
    S8/B7/M1/A2/H45 (Warrior) or H35 (Rogue)
    Abilities: Fearless (sp), First cut (pa), Steadfast (pa), Might of Stone (mo), Piercing (co), Charm (mo) x3, Lightning (pa).

    While with the Mage i filled all available items' slots, here i haven't equipped the Necklace; when i had the chance to equip one i have chosen a different reward.

    With this build i even did better than the Mage, where i have lost a couple of fights; here i had only 1 defeat with legendary monster quest 49, that's why i played it after the Hardest quest 87, the better equipment helped me.
